Transaction adaf24822ea65153bf179501472e1e2490a7315f734245e89f3b10f010790f32

2 Input
1 Outputs
  • adaf24822ea65153bf179501472e1e2490a7315f734245e89f3b10f010790f32:0
  • value  2336068
    address  37L4StdRjAEoZoXJsn5jjNPzpdescRHiVz